Why the dividend calendar matters now

The latest item does not point to a profit warning or a fresh deal announcement; instead, it centers on timing. Ex-dividend dates often draw attention because buyers need to own the shares before that date to qualify for the next payout, and that can shift short-term interest in a stock even when the business outlook has not changed. Ad-hoc-news says Huntington Bancshares' ex-dividend date is expected in calendar week 25, which places it on the radar for income-focused investors.

Huntington Bancshares at a glance

  • Name: Huntington Bancshares Incorporated
  • Industry: Regional banking
  • Headquarters: Columbus, Ohio, United States
  • Core markets: Midwest and other selected US banking markets
  • Revenue drivers: Net interest income, fee-based banking services, and treasury management
  • Listing: Nasdaq, ticker HBAN
  • Trading currency: US dollars
